When's the best time for an all-inclusive stay in Isla de Utila?
There's nothing like an all-inclusive holiday in Isla de Utila to revive you, especially when you know what kind of weather to expect. Here's some information to help you decide when to book: The hottest months are usually May and June, with an average temperature of 26°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 23°C. April and March are the driest months, while November and October are the rainiest months.
